Depicted in the revered Bhumisparsa Mudra, Shakyamuni Buddha extends his right hand toward the earth symbolizing the moment of enlightenment beneath the Bodhi tree. His left hand gently cradles an alms bowl representing the path to inner wisdom. The Buddha is seated gracefully in Padmasana atop a finely detailed lotus seat, while an ornate halo rises behind him, embellished with floral carvings and semi-precious stones inlay that enhance his divine presence.

About Shakyamuni Buddha

The Shakyamuni Buddha represents Siddhartha Gautama, the historical Buddha and founder of Buddhism, who attained complete enlightenment under the Bodhi tree over 2,500 years ago. Revered as the "Sage of the Shakya Clan," Shakyamuni Buddha embodies wisdom, compassion, and the path to liberation from suffering. Through his teachings, known as the Dharma, he revealed the Noble Eightfold Path and the Four Noble Truths, guiding countless beings toward spiritual freedom and lasting happiness. His enlightened presence is invoked through the sacred mantra "Om Muni Muni Maha Muniye Soha", which devotees chant to cultivate wisdom and awaken the qualities of compassion and enlightenment within themselves.
